Ping, Latency and UX

Last Updated 19/09/2024

Content

What is Ping?

Ping is a network utility used to test the reachability of a server by sending a data packet to it and measuring the time it takes for a response to be received. Ping is typically measured in milliseconds (ms), and a lower ping value indicates faster communication between the client and server. It is often used to assess the responsiveness of a network or website and is crucial for applications like online gaming or real-time communication.

What is Latency?

Latency refers to the time delay between a user’s action (such as clicking a link or sending a request) and the response from the server. Latency is also measured in milliseconds and directly impacts the user experience. Lower latency means faster response times, making interactions with a website or application feel more immediate and responsive. High latency, on the other hand, results in noticeable delays, leading to frustration and poor user satisfaction.

What are Loading Times?

Loading Times measure the duration it takes for a webpage or application to fully load and become usable after a user initiates a request. This includes the time it takes to load all content, such as images, scripts, and text. Faster loading times are essential for delivering a seamless user experience, especially in an era where users expect instant access to information and services. Slow loading times often lead to higher bounce rates, where users abandon a site before it fully loads.

The Importance of Ping, Latency, and Loading Times for User Experience

The performance of a website or application, as measured by ping, latency, and loading times, has a significant impact on the overall user experience. Here's why these factors matter:

  • User Satisfaction: Fast response times make interactions feel smooth and intuitive. If a website responds quickly, users are more likely to stay, engage, and return. Delays of just a few seconds can lead to frustration, reducing satisfaction and user engagement.
  • Retention and Conversion Rates: Studies show that slow websites have higher abandonment rates. If a page takes longer than 3 seconds to load, over half of mobile users will leave. For e-commerce sites, faster loading times directly correlate to higher conversion rates and increased revenue.
  • SEO Ranking: Search engines like Google prioritize faster websites in their rankings. Websites with lower latency and faster loading times are more likely to rank higher, leading to increased visibility and traffic.
  • Real-Time Applications: For gaming, video conferencing, or live streaming, low ping and latency are critical for maintaining smooth performance. High latency leads to lag, which can disrupt gameplay or conversations, negatively affecting the user experience.

Research Insights on Performance and User Experience

Research has consistently highlighted the importance of performance in user experience, particularly around latency and loading times. According to studies conducted by Google and other industry leaders:

  • Google Research: Google found that a delay of just 1 second in mobile page load times can reduce conversion rates by up to 20%. This shows how critical fast performance is for keeping users engaged and driving business results.
  • Amazon Case Study: Amazon reported that for every 100-millisecond increase in page load time, sales decreased by 1%. This demonstrates how even small delays can have a direct impact on user behavior and revenue generation.
  • Akamai Study: According to Akamai, 53% of mobile users will abandon a site if it takes longer than 3 seconds to load. Additionally, websites with faster load times experience significantly higher customer retention and satisfaction rates.
  • Ping and Latency for Real-Time Applications: Studies in gaming and streaming industries have shown that latency above 100 milliseconds can cause noticeable delays, affecting the user experience. In competitive gaming, even a difference of 20-30 milliseconds can be the difference between winning and losing.

Conclusion

Ping, latency, and loading times are vital components of website and application performance. Research clearly shows that users expect fast, responsive interactions, and even minor delays can lead to frustration, decreased engagement, and loss of revenue. By prioritizing performance optimization, businesses can improve user satisfaction, enhance retention, and gain a competitive edge.